Microsoft .NET Framework 2.0:简介和重要特性

王尘宇 问题解答 131
如果你正在寻找一种方法来提高你的工作效率,那么本文microsoft.net.framework2.0将为你提供一些有用的技巧。

1. 什么是Microsoft .NET Framework 2.0

Microsoft .NET Framework 2.0是由微软公司推出的一个软件开发框架,为开发者提供了一个强大的工具集,用于创建和管理Windows应用程序。它是.NET Framework的一个重要更新版本,带来了许多新的功能和改进,使开发过程更加高效和简化。

2. 新功能和改进

2.1 增强的语言集成

Microsoft .NET Framework 2.0引入了针对C#和VB.NET等编程语言的一些重要改进。引入了泛型(Generic)类型,使得代码更加灵活和可重用。还提供了更强大的对委托(Delegate)和事件(Event)的支持,使开发者能够更好地处理异步操作和回调函数。

2.2 更好的性能和可靠性

.NET Framework 2.0通过引入一些优化措施,提升了应用程序的性能和可靠性。其中包括对JIT编译器的改进,使得代码的执行速度更快。还改进了垃圾回收器(Garbage Collector)的算法,减少了内存泄漏和资源浪费的问题。

2.3 新的类库和控件

.NET Framework 2.0为开发者提供了丰富的类库和控件,能够简化开发过程并提高用户体验。其中包括Windows Presentation Foundation(WPF)和Windows Communication Foundation(WCF)等新的技术,使开发者能够更轻松地创建出色的用户界面和分布式应用程序。

2.4 更好的安全性

在.NET Framework 2.0中,微软加强了对应用程序的安全性。引入了代码访问安全(Code Access Security)机制,通过对代码的权限进行控制,防止恶意代码的执行。还提供了更强大的加密和身份验证功能,保护用户数据的安全。

3. 使用 Microsoft .NET Framework 2.0 的好处

3.1 提高开发效率

.NET Framework 2.0提供了丰富的开发工具和类库,使开发者能够更快速地构建应用程序。通过使用现有的类和控件,开发者无需从头开始编写代码,可以节省大量的时间和精力。

3.2 支持多语言开发

.NET Framework 2.0支持多种编程语言,包括C#、VB.NET、F#等,使得开发者能够根据自己的喜好和经验选择合适的语言进行开发。这种灵活性不仅提高了开发效率,还提供了更多的选择和可能性。

3.3 可移植性和跨平台性

由于.NET Framework 2.0是跨平台的,开发的应用程序可以在不同的操作系统上运行,如Windows、Linux等。这种可移植性使得应用程序更具灵活性和可扩展性,能够满足不同用户的需求。

4. 总结

Microsoft .NET Framework 2.0是一个功能强大的软件开发框架,提供了许多有用的工具和功能,可以极大地简化开发过程并提高应用程序的性能和可靠性。通过使用.NET Framework 2.0,开发者可以更高效地构建出色的应用程序,并提供给用户优秀的用户体验。

在本文中,我们详细介绍了microsoft.net.framework2.0,在未来的文章中,我们将继续探讨...。

标签: Microsoft .NET Framework 软件开发

发布评论 0条评论)

  • Refresh code

还木有评论哦,快来抢沙发吧~